How much state tax do I owe Louisiana?

Income Tax Brackets

Single Filers
Louisiana Taxable Income Rate
$0 – $12,500 2.00%
$12,500 – $50,000 4.00%
$50,000+ 6.00%

What is my Louisiana Revenue Account number?

The LA Department of Revenue Account Number for the Business can be found on the first page of your Louisiana income tax return, Louisiana sales tax return, or Louisiana employer withholding form. The format for the account # is #######-001 for Partnerships, LLCs, and Corporations.

Will I get my federal refund if I owe state taxes?

The IRS can seize some or all of your refund if you owe federal or state back taxes. It also can seize your refund if you default on child support or student loan debts. If you think a mistake has been made you can contact the IRS.

What is the deadline to pay Louisiana state taxes?

May 15th
Due Date of Returns and Payments
Returns and payments are due on or before May 15th of the following year. For fiscal year taxpayers, returns and payments are due on the 15th day of the fifth month after the close of the fiscal year.

What happens if you file taxes late?

Usually, the failure to file penalty is 5% of the tax owed for each month or part of a month that a tax return is late, up to five months, reduced by the failure to pay penalty amount for any month where both penalties apply.

Why would I get a letter from Louisiana Department of Revenue?

If your tax return is under audit, you will receive written correspondence in the mail from an LDR tax auditor with detailed information concerning your audit. An auditor may call you first to verify contact information.

Is underpayment penalty waived for 2021?

The IRS has announced (Notice 2021-08) that it will waive the addition to tax under IRC Section 6654 for an individual taxpayer’s underpayment of estimated tax if the underpayment is attributable to changes the Coronavirus Aid, Relief, and Economic Security Act (CARES Act) made to IRC Section 461(l)(1)(B).
